Securing Business Funding: A Guide to Loans and Funding Sources

Acquiring the necessary capital to launch or grow a business can be a difficult task. Fortunately, there are numerous funding sources available to entrepreneurs. One popular choice is securing a traditional loan from a financial institution. These loans typically involve a thorough underwriting, and lenders will consider factors such as your financial standing before making a decision.

Alternatively, you can explore creative capital options. These include microloans, which may be more accessible to startups or businesses with limited financial records. It's essential to carefully evaluate your capital requirements and research the various choices presented to find the best fit for your business.

Strengthening Your Cash Flow

Working capital is crucial for businesses of all sizes. It signifies the funds available to cover immediate operating expenses and address financial obligations.

To maximize working capital, consider these effective approaches:

* Streamline your inventory management to reduce holding costs.

* Negotiate favorable payment terms with suppliers to prolong your payment period.

* Invoice promptly to accelerate the receipt of funds.

* Explore short-term financing solutions such as lines of credit to fund cash shortfalls.

Continuously review your working capital position and adjust your approaches as needed.
